F10 BMW M5 by Platinum Motorsport

A new project custom designed around the F10 BMW M5 has come about and it’s pretty hard to identify simply by name. It has so many hit ideas it’s more of a reunited album than anything else.

Interestingly, the project kicked off when the owner decided to change the paint of his M5. He decided to go from a factory white to a custom gray.

Not the most uplifting of changes, especially considering the new shade is as business boring as it comes. Take a closer look at that gray though.

Platinum Motorsport oversaw the project and they decided that a simple shade will not do, which is why they opted for Grigio Telesto.

That’s straight out of the Lamborghini option book. The new body kit comes from a company much closer to BMW, Kelleners Sport.

Now that the modding ball had picked up some speed, nobody really wanted to see it stop rolling, so changes went beyond the visual.

The F10 M5’s suspension now features a KW Coilover kit, the exhaust system is a Meisterschaft GTC unit and features four split tail pipes.

Underneath it all, a new set of Agetro 3piece Forged F500 21 inch alloys goes on. Unusually, they are painted different shades of black on the driver side compared to those on the passenger side.

Another grip boost is provided by the Falken FK452 tires. Given the new setup, they are now 255/30-21 at the front and 295/25-21 at the back.

The only thing missing is some extra power from the engine. Then again, some people reckon the 560 horses it comes with by default are more than enough.
